Oakbark Side-Pull
This Western side pull is a type of bridle designed to give horse riders more control over their horse’s movements. The bridle consists of a headpiece, a throatlatch, noseband and rein, all connected to a bit in the horse’s mouth. The rein connects to the bit on one side and is pulled by the rider to help control the horse’s head and neck movements. The design of the bridle allows for more direct control over the horse’s movements, making it particularly useful for controlling horses that are difficult to manage.
